BJP MP Parvesh Verma has kicked off a row by claiming that if the BJP comes to power in Delhi then it will not only clear the Shaheen Bagh area of the anti-CAA protesters within an hour, but will also remove all existing mosques in his parliamentary constituency built on government land within a month. While addressing a small crowd inside a room in the Vikaspuri Assembly constituency, BJP's west Delhi MP said: "This is not just another election. It is an election to decide the unity of a nation. | ||||||||
